on the answer key, it only factored out 2 for 2x+2y only? i dont know why. Can you explain to me?
If we are going to get x^2, y^2, xy and a constant term, it has to factor like this: (ax+by+c)(dx+ey+f) Since we'll need a coefficient of 1 on x^2, then a = d = 1 (x+by+c)(x+ey+f) Since we'll need a coefficient of 1 on y^2, then b = e = 1 (x+y+c)(x+y+f) By a little luck, maybe, this also produces 2xy. Since we'll need a constant term of -8, then c*f = -8 The coefficients on x and y suggest also that c + f = 2 Can you solve for c and f?
If you like, we can treat it like any other quadratic expressions. x^2 + 2xy + y^2 + 2x + 2y - 8 (x^2 + 2xy + y^2) + (2x + 2y) - 8 (x + y)^2 + 2(x + y) - 8 If this said, z^2 + 2z - 8, could you factor it? ((x+y)+4)((x+y)-2)
